Resumo: | Introduction: Physical exercise is indicated as a prophylactic measure in the treatment of osteoporosis, decreasing the loss of bone mass, as well as, in some cases providing its remodeling. Objective: To analyze, through a systematic review, the scientific evidence about the effects of physical exercise on bone mineral density in the elderly. Method: This is a study of systematic review of the literature, carried out in the databases SciELO, BVS, PubMed, Web of Science through controlled descriptors, Elderly, Exercise and Bone Mineral Density, as well as their translations into Spanish and English, according to DeCS and Mesh, published between 2014 and 2019. Results: Taking into account the Exercise Protocol, the most applied tests were, Dual Energy X-Ray (DXA) with 66.66% following by calculating the body mass index (BMI) with 22.22%, in addition to the walking tests, Clinical Falls Risk Assessment Instrument (QuickScreen), Timed Up and Go (TUG), Functional Reach Test (FRT), 1 maximum repetition (1RM), vertical vibration Fitvibe Excel Pro platform, all with 11.12%. It is worth mentioning that there was a significant relationship between physical exercise and the increase in BMD, in the selected studies. Conclusion: According to the results obtained in this review, we can conclude that physical exercise plays a significant role in the prophylaxis and treatment of osteoporosis. |
